5G vs 6G Network Technologies

Key Takeaways

The evolution from 5G to 6G is set to revolutionize networking technologies. While 5G focuses on enhancing mobile broadband, 6G aims to integrate AI-driven solutions, offering unprecedented speed and connectivity. Key areas include latency reduction, infrastructure advancements, and cloud networking improvements.

Latency Reduction

5G networks have significantly reduced latency compared to previous generations. However, 6G promises to push boundaries further, achieving near-zero latency. This is crucial for applications like autonomous vehicles and remote surgeries.

Infrastructure Upgrades

5G networks require significant infrastructure changes, such as small cells and fiber optics. 6G will further demand advanced materials and technologies to support higher frequencies.

Cloud Networking Improvements

5G facilitates enhanced cloud networking capabilities, enabling seamless data processing and storage. 6G will take this further by integrating AI and edge computing for real-time analytics.
